A substitute motion was made by Vice President Goldberg,
seconded by Commissioner Sievers, to Recommend to the City
Manager the use GeoFil/GeoTurf or coconut fiber mix/all natural
fiber materials as the standard infill material for all synthetic field
projects in City of Long Beach Parks. The motion carried by the
following vote:
Yes: 3 - Stacey Morrison, Ron Sievers and Benjamin Alan Goldberg
No: 2 - Julie Heggeness and Ron Antonette
Absent: 1 - David Zanatta

A substitute motion was made by Vice President Goldberg and
seconded by Commissioner Heggeness to approve the
installation of 4 foot fence and lighting at El Dorado Park Soccer
Field #1 with field overlay design for youth soccer versus adult
soccer activities with priority to Parks, Recreation & Marine
programs, Long Beach Unified School District programs and 18
and under programs, with activities ending promptly at 9pm.
Yes: 5 - Julie Heggeness, Stacey Morrison, Ron Sievers, Benjamin
Alan Goldberg and Ron Antonette
Absent: 1 - David Zanatta
